Got mine yesterday and have watched everything but the commentary. I didn't think there was all that much more violence in the unrated version, but there was certainly more things said that is likely to offend the more PC crowd in this country. I do like how some scenes have been restored within the movie but others are still left out. The ones that are left out are left out for good reason.
The extras are a bit weird. There is plenty of your standard making of stuff which is all cool, but there is also a couple of short films that take place within the DOTD "universe" I guess you'd say. However, as entertaining as they can be, they are mostly played for comedy it seems. I found myself disappointed in the tone of these parts, but must admit I found myself laughing a few times as well, particularly at one specific line spoken by Tom Savini on a newscast. Also, it seemed at one point the Andy character took a playful shot at 28 Days Later. (paraphrasing here- "I'm running low of food, but that's okay, you can go, like, 28 days without eating". Perhaps referencing Jim from 28 Days Later, lying unfed, in the hospital in that movie. Or am I reading too much into that?)
Still, if you can play all regions, this is a great disc to get.
